I have seen sun light and even a full moon cause the … WebOne cause of this type of intermittent problem is that direct sunlight can blind the optical safety sensors once the door is open. The receiving sensor can't detect the beam generated by the other side and won't allow the door to close. As the sun moves throughout day, the exposure changes and the door then closes normally again.
